TP-Link® powerline networking accessories enable you to expand your LAN and Wi-Fi® coverage to areas where the signal is weak or nonexistent. Use these devices to build unified networks via existing powerlines to enjoy stable network coverage. Plug the gaps in your wireless network by routing traffic through your electrical outlets. This unique design eliminates unsightly cables and the need for rewiring. TP-Link powerline adapters come with companion tpPLC™ Utility software, which provides simple access to network security and management tools. Download the tpPLC app to view real-time network speeds and control LEDs from your iOS® or Android™ powered smart device. Automated power-saving modes minimize wireless adapter energy consumption when not in use, saving you costs. Once paired, these adapters automatically encrypt the data sent between them for increased network security. Built-in 128-bit Advanced Encryption Standard (AES) encoding engines protect your confidential data from online attacks. With orthogonal frequency division multiplexing (OFDM) modulation technology, these adapters run optimally and efficiently in severe channel conditions. Made with a noise filter, a TP-Link Ethernet adapter eliminates electrical signal noise to enhance network transmission performance.
